    What happened

    Mexico has officially agreed to host Iran's national football team during the 2026 FIFA World Cup after the United States declined to accommodate them. This decision was confirmed by Claudia Sheinbaum, the President of Mexico, during a press conference. The U.S. refusal was rooted in ongoing political tensions with Iran, prompting FIFA to seek an alternative host for the Iranian squad.

    As a result, Iran will play all three of its group matches in the U.S. while being based in Mexico. This arrangement marks a significant diplomatic gesture from Mexico, stepping in to support the Iranian team amid a complex international landscape.

    The Context

    The backdrop of this decision involves heightened tensions between the U.S. and Iran, which have influenced various aspects of international relations. FIFA's intervention to find a solution for the Iranian team's accommodation reflects the organization's role in navigating these complexities during global sporting events. Claudia Sheinbaum's announcement on May 25, 2026, came shortly after the U.S. officially declined to host the Iranian squad.

    This situation illustrates how sports can serve as a conduit for diplomacy, especially when political climates are strained. The decision also positions Mexico as a potential mediator in international relations, particularly in the context of U.S.-Iran dynamics.
